Did you know that the hour before bed can influence how easily children settle and sleep?
More and more parents are looking for screen-free activities before bed that help toddlers and preschoolers wind down without becoming overstimulated. Open-ended play can be a wonderful option because children set the pace themselves. There are no flashing lights, rapid scene changes or constant stimulation. Just imagination, storytelling .
Whether it’s driving around a play rug, building a small world, or creating their own adventures, imaginative play gives children a chance to slow down and transition from a busy day into bedtime.
